Here’s an overview of 2011 packaging mergers & acquisitions activity globally and in North America via BMO Capital Markets’ The Converter.
Global Historical Deal Volume – Global packaging M&A volume continued to strengthen in 2011 after rebounding in 2010 from historic lows in 2009.
North American Historical Deal Volume – North American transaction volume (deals in which the target was located in the US or Canada) also increased in 2011.
Deal Volume by Sector – Deal activity in North America was relatively similar to the global market. Variance in volume between the different sectors is primarily attributed to differences in overall market size and varying degrees of fragmentation.
